From the Pastor’s Desk
 
Greetings Living Hope family! Things are happening pretty fast on the transition from closure to reopening. At the time of this writing, the Elder Board has decided to reopen the church for in-person worship on Sunday, June 7th at our regular time of 10:30 a.m. We also decided to meet in the Gym rather than the Worship Center Auditorium. In the Gym, we have more room to keep a safe distance apart and the air circulation will help disperse airborne pathogens to the outside. We are using the Gym temporarily, a measure taken out of an abundance of caution as we begin this transition back to in-person worship. We expect to be back in the Worship Center very soon.
 
We have a lot of bases to cover in taking adequate precautions for our regathering, but it is definitely time to assemble ourselves together again. We will be sending out guidelines via email and our Facebook page in the days leading up to June 7th. Please be patient, please be flexible as we continue to do things that none of us have ever done before, either as individuals or as a church community.
 
I would also take this opportunity to encourage us all to remember the focus of our regathering: we exist to make disciples of our Lord Jesus. All the precautions we take to protect one another from infection is to facilitate our mission. So, while we are being sensitive to people’s virus concerns, let us also be sensitive to the visitors to welcome them to Living Hope and share with them the reason for our hope. With God’s guidance and our love for Him and for one another, we will move forward in advancing the Gospel of Jesus Christ to our corner of the Globe.

From the Pastor's Desk
Just a short note this month. I have been impressed with many truths during this time of sheltering in place. Among them is this one: The church buildings are merely tools. The “Church” is its people. Buildings do not make disciples, people make disciples. And for Living Hope Church, we exist to make disciples of Jesus Christ.
 
I enjoy the “tools” God has entrusted to us. It is important that we keep them up and that we use them in the mission to which we have been called. But sometimes we get so enamored with the tools that we forget the real identity of the Church: people! Thus, as we have discovered in this time of separation, doing ministry involves our people, not our buildings.
 
I do indeed look forward to that time when we can again be together. When we can use those tools for worship, Bible study, prayer, fellowship, evangelism, and so on. But we must never forget this lesson that our ministry is about influencing the lives of people (making disciples), not mere activities inside of our buildings.
